Had my first scary moment with my P3A the other day.
I tried to lod a Litchi mission but it refused, saying the GPS signal was too weak, so I just tried flying it around manually. It started swaying aroud violently and controls were unresponsive. Then it just sped off. I thought I was about to see the last of it, as it wouldn't stop when I ordered it to. Eventually I had to steer it back in my direction using the yaw control. Finally, I got it to land.
When I analysed the log with Healthy Drones, I found it had switched between ATTI and GPS over 30 times in a minute and a half, which apparently is a sign of a weak GPS signal.
I've done one Litchi mission since, and it was fine. But a mystery remains: why did it say the GPS signal was weak when it was picking up 16 satellites?
